Mashup Score: 2Study sheds new light on hormone therapy as menopause treatment - 1 year(s) ago
Vanderbilt research shows that hormone replacement therapy can be safely administered depending on the method used and the patient’s age, time since menopause, and risk of cardiovascular disease.

Mashup Score: 0Drugs and Lactation Database (LactMed®) - 1 year(s) ago
The LactMed® database contains information on drugs and other chemicals to which breastfeeding mothers may be exposed. It includes information on the levels of such substances in breast milk and infant blood, and the possible adverse effects in the nursing infant. Suggested therapeutic alternatives to those drugs are provided, where appropriate. All data are derived from the scientific literature…
